Alpine Renault A110 1300 Rallye

Category:

Description

The Alpine Renault A110 1300 Rallye was a competition-focused variant of the A110, designed for rallying and motorsport success in the late 1960s and early 1970s. It combined the lightweight fiberglass body and rear-engine layout of the standard A110 with a more powerful engine and performance upgrades to enhance handling and durability on demanding rally stages.

Powered by a 1.3-liter inline-four engine sourced from the Renault 8 Gordini, the A110 1300 Rallye produced around 110 to 120 horsepower, depending on tuning. This power was delivered to the rear wheels through a close-ratio four- or five-speed manual transmission, providing rapid acceleration and precise control. The car’s low weight, typically under 700 kg, contributed to its exceptional agility and responsiveness.

The aerodynamic coupe body retained Alpine’s signature round headlights and low-slung profile, optimized for high-speed stability. Suspension modifications, reinforced chassis components, and improved braking systems made the 1300 Rallye more capable in competition, allowing it to handle rough terrain and tight corners with precision.

As part of the A110 lineup, the 1300 Rallye played a significant role in establishing Alpine’s dominance in rally racing, paving the way for later, more powerful versions that would lead to major victories, including in the World Rally Championship. It was particularly effective on winding mountain roads, where its lightweight construction and superior handling gave it an edge over larger, more powerful competitors.

Today, the Alpine Renault A110 1300 Rallye is a rare and highly collectible classic, valued for its motorsport heritage and exhilarating driving dynamics. Enthusiasts and collectors seek well-preserved examples, recognizing their importance in Alpine’s racing history and their role in shaping the legend of the A110.
